javascript中数据类型以及遍历数组的方法

57 阅读1分钟

1.javascript中基本数据类型和复杂数据类型有哪些?

  • 基本数据类型:数据类型(Number) , 字符串类型(string) ,布尔类型(boolean),未定义类型(undefined),空(null)
  • 复杂数据类型:对象(obj),数组(arr),函数(function)

2.遍历数组的几种方式

  • 可以使用for循环进行遍历 语法:for(let i=0;i<arr.length;i++){}
  • 可以使用forEach进行遍历 语法:arr.forEach(function (element, index){}
  • 可以使用map进行遍历 语法:array.map(function(ele,index,arr), value){}

注意事项:使用map遍历返回值是一个新的数组,forEach没有返回值(undefined)

3.事件监听的三要素以及常见的事件类型

  • 事件三要素:事件源 ,事件类型,事件处理函数(程序)
  • 常见的事件类型:点击事件(click),鼠标事件(mouseenter,mouseleave),焦点事件(focus,blur)input事件和键盘事件(keydown input keyup)